Mistlurkers, also known as fog beasts, as their name implies, are creatures that lurk within the fog and mists and appear to be made of it. They make their first appearance with the World of Warcraft: Mists of Pandaria expansion. The Jailer held strange creatures that appeared to be some sort of Maw version of these creatures, known as Maw fog beasts.

Normally mindless and predatory, the ones of the Townlong Sumprushes show signs of intelligence. Mistlurkers, specifically known as fog beasts, are found as well in the Ringing Deeps.

Background

A mistlurker.
A Emerald Nightmare mistlurker.

The mistlurkers are primitive peaceful creatures living in the Lower and Upper Sumprushes of Townlong Steppes. At some point, the yaungol shaman, who used special torches to communicate with them, started working alongside them. However, recently the mist-shaman started using those same torches to control and kill the mistlurkers who refused their orders.[1] Most of them do not speak the languages spoken by humans or orcs, however a few like Orbiss have learned to speak it.[2]

The mist helps sustain their bodies. Mist that is warm and fragrant, like the mist in the Upper Sumprushes, is nutritive to them.[3] They also ingest plants[4] and plant-like creatures, like the nature spirits[5] and drink the blood of creatures they can capture.[6]

The crew of the Barnacle encountered a mistlurker when venturing into the caves of the Timeless Isle. They were surprised when the moss and lichen lining the wall detached itself and began shambling toward them. A choking gas billowed from the mistlurker's many fungal blossoms. The vines and ferns making up its hide regrew rapidly wherever it was struck.[7]

Mistlurkers are also found on the fungus-covered world Naigtal accessed through Invasion Points. One Mistlurker is known to live on Argus, the Tar Spitter.

The fog beasts of the Ringing Deeps are noted to be largely passive, dwelling in various areas. The Machine Speakers are not fond of fog beasts, as their fog tends to rust things.[8] A number of them came to inhabit Camp Murroch; causing issues for the camp's 'owner', Clive DelGizmo. They were scared away with static discharge as an idea from the earthen, Danagh; telling Clive that harming them was illogical.[9] When questioned as to where fog beasts came from, Danagh claims their origins are unknown. The earthen believe they are creations or byproducts of titan work. His mentor, Foreman Arbauch, was more superstitious concerning the fog beasts. He claimed harming them would bring bad luck[10] and that they were the byproduct of memories overflowing from the earthen.

Notes

  • These creatures share the skeleton and animations of fungal giants.
  • Most mistlurkers are elementals, with a few exceptions who are abberrations.
